Secluded Black Hills Studio Cabin Near Crazy Horse and Custer State Park

  • Unique property bordering the Black Hills National Forest on 3 sides with an easy access county road on the other, the cabin features a full bathroom, a full kitchen, a queen-sized bed in a studio setting, and a comfortable, reclining couch. Although just minutes from Custer, you're truly in the country with hundreds of thousands of connected Forest Service acres to explore or simply view from the front porch. The cabin makes a great location as a home base for touring the many sites of the Black Hills.

    The cabin is fully furnished with high-speed fiber internet (great work from home location), expansive DirecTv package (also Roku with guest mode to bring your own streaming channels, too), air conditioner, kitchen appliances, flatware, linens, towels, and everything needed for a comfortable stay. Professionally cleaned and laundered between stays.

    Rarely you'll find a single or couples cabin in the Hills on an acreage where you aren't sharing the property with other cabins and guests, but here you'll be completely alone as you'll have the entire property to yourself to experience the peace and tranquility of the Black Hills in a way you may not have thought was possible. Step out the cabin door to hike the adjoining Forest Service land just a few yards up the hill for a spectacular view of Crazy Horse!

About the area

Located in Custer, this cabin is in a rural area and in the mountains. While the natural beauty of Custer State Park and Black Hills National Forest can be enjoyed by anyone, those looking for an activity can explore Sylvan Lake. Needles Highway and South Dakota State Railroad Museum are also worth visiting. Enjoy the area's slopes with cross-country skiing, and don't miss out on the snowmobiling.
